Tasting card

nose

A luscious sweet aroma of maple butter leads with plenty of chalky vanilla, caramelized sugars, complex pot still fruitiness including bitter citrus, apple skins and marmalade, with ginger, clove, and a touch of roasted nuts.

palate

Creamy vanilla and malty notes intertwine with gentle sherried fruit, coconut, honey-toffee sweetness, apricot, peach melba, milk chocolate, spiced nuts, peppery mint, and pot still spices.

finish

Long and warming with honeyed sweetness, mild drying oak spice, and a hint of sherry-scorched wood.
